GNOME Bugzilla – Bug 559350
add the possibility to umount volumes
Last modified: 2009-06-18 15:29:39 UTC
In the places menu there should be an umount icon on the right of the menu item, so that we can easily umount volumes faster than now (now we have to open nautilus to umount volumes) The change should be trivial, but I'm not an expert of GTK so I cannot create a GtkMenuItem with two icons and two callbacks, depending on where the user clicks. Maybe the correct thing is to create 2 menu items and collapse them in a single one, but I still don't know how to do it... The file to touch is panel-menu-items.c, function panel_menu_item_append_mount Can you help?
